1 kg = 2.2 pounds 1 cm = 0.39 inch so 1 kg/cm2 = 2.2/(0.39)^2 psi = 14.2 psi

To convert from lb/sq. in to kg/sq. cm multiply by 0.0704. (As lb = 0.454kg, sq. in = 6.452 sq. cm and so lb/sq. in = 0.454/6.452 = 0.0704 kg/sq. cm)
